The township committee moved to withdraw an ordinance that would have amended Chapter 6 (Township Clerk, deputy clerk) to confirm deputy custodians of records and update Open Public Records Act fees, introduced Ordinance 26 to repeal a 2002 ordinance and confirm title to Lot 3801, and approved a consent calendar and bills by roll call.

The township committee discussed an ordinance to amend Chapter 6 of the township code — section 6-12, "Township Clerk, deputy township clerk" — that would have confirmed designation of departmental deputy custodians of records under the clerk and updated fees to align with the New Jersey Open Public Records Act (N.J.S.A. 47:1A-1 and following.) During the meeting a motion was made and seconded to withdraw that ordinance. The committee took a roll-call vote on the motion to withdraw; the motion carried, and the ordinance was withdrawn. Separately, the committee introduced Ordinance 26 of 2025. The ordinance repeals Ordinance 3 of 2002 and confirms title to a property identified as Block 3801, Lot [number transcribed as "Wound" / Lot Long Street Avenue], with a public hearing scheduled for Nov. 12, 2025, at 5 p.m. A motion to introduce Ordinance 26 passed on roll call. The committee also approved a consent calendar (designated in the meeting as items numbered through a consent range) and moved to pay bills; both motions passed on roll-call votes.
